This Friday the Hawk Mountain Sanctuary presents an award to Tom Cade, the Boise, Idaho guy credited with doing much to save the endangered peregrine falcon. You can read about it in the Allentown, Pennsylvania, Morning Call.

Cade played a major role in reviving the nearly extinct peregrine falcon in the 1970s. As a graduate student, he studied how a pesticide contributed to their sharp population decline. He eventually founded a conservation group, The Peregrine Fund, which reintroduced captivity-bred birds to the wild.

. . . The falcon’s revival is widely considered one of the most successful recoveries of an endangered species. The species teetered on the brink of extinction in 1970, when as few as 39 known pairs of nesting falcons existed. A 2003 survey puts the number of nesting pairs at more than 3,100.

On Thursday Cade will receive the Sarkis Acopian Award for Distinguished Achievement in Raptor Conservation.  According to The Morning Call, “The award is given infrequently by Hawk Mountain officials and is named after the Kempton-area bird sanctuary’s primary benefactor, a late philanthropist who studied engineering at Lafayette College.”

International health care expert César Chelala argues that the “War Against Malaria Can Be Won, Without DDT” at the on-line Epoch Times. Chelala reports on a project in Mexico — where DDT use has never stopped since 1946 — a project now extended to other places in Central America, demonstrating that the tried and true methods of preventing mosquitoes from breeding and avoiding contact work well to fight malaria.  Plus, he says, it’s cheaper than using DDT.  Doubt that it could work?  Chelala points out that the Panama Canal could not be dug without controlling mosquito-borne illnesses, and the Canal was opened in 1914, 25 years before DDT was demonstrated to be deadly to insects, more than 30 years before widespread deployment of DDT.

Early detection and treatment is critical to eliminate the parasite carriers. An important aspect of this project has been the collaboration of voluntary community health workers who are taught to make an early diagnosis in situ and to administer complete courses of treatment not only to those affected but also to the patients’ immediate contacts.

The project was carried out in specific pilot areas called “demonstration areas” which had been selected due to their high levels of malaria transmission. In those areas, the number of malaria cases fell 63% from 2004 to 2007. In several demonstration areas I visited in Honduras and Mexico as a consultant for the Pan American Health Organization malaria had practically been eliminated. Plans are underway to expand the project to other regions where malaria remains a serious threat.

One of the advantages of not using DDT (besides avoiding its toxic effects) is the enormous savings realized from discontinuing its routine use. These savings can now be put to good use with other diseases.

Meanwhile, from Uganda comes news that DDT spraying failed to reduce malaria in spraying done in that nation. Proponents expected a sharp and steep decline in malaria, but numbers are not greatly reduced.  Even after taking account for the legal difficulties of spraying, after conservative businessmen sought an injunction to stop DDT use, the results do not speak well for DDT’s effectiveness.

Contrary to expectations, data collected by health departments in Apac and Oyam districts, which record the highest malaria incidence in the world, do not reflect significant improvements since DDT spraying ended prematurely. From May to July 2008, which is the period immediately following the spraying, between 400 and 600 clinical malaria cases per 100,000 of the population were reported per week in Oyam; and 600 to 800 such cases in Apac for the same period. These are almost exactly the same as the number of cases reported between January and April 2008.

Getting news out of Africa is not always easy.  Reading reports from Ugandan papers, it becomes clear that reporting standards differ greatly from the U.S. to Uganda.  Still, the saga from Uganda demonstrates that DDT is no panacea.  Uganda is a nation that had not used DDT extensively prior to the mid-1960s.  Resistance to use now comes from tobacco and cotton interests who speciously claim that potential DDT contamination of crops would result in the European Union banning vital Ugandan exports.  The legal issues all alone assume Shakespearean tragedy dimensions.  Or, perhaps more accurately, we could call the story Kafkaesque.

Viewers of NOVA tonight get to see some of the pride of Dallas on display.  “Arctic Dinosaurs” documents the work of a paleontologist from the Dallas Museum of Nature and Science digging dinosaurs in or near the Arctic Circle.

NOVA takes viewers on an exciting Arctic trek as one team of paleontologists attempts a radical “dig” in northern Alaska, using explosives to bore a 60-foot tunnel into the permafrost in search of fossil bones. Both the scientists and the filmmakers face many challenges while on location, including plummeting temperatures and eroding cliffs prone to sudden collapse. Meanwhile, a second team of scientists works high atop a treacherous cliff to unearth a massive skull, all the while battling time, temperature, and voracious mosquitoes.

The hardy scientists shadowed in “Arctic Dinosaurs” persevere because they are driven by a compelling riddle: How did dinosaurs—long believed to be cold-blooded animals—endure the bleak polar environment and navigate in near-total darkness during the long winter months? Did they migrate over hundreds of miles of rough terrain like modern-day herds of caribou in search of food? Or did they enter a dormant state of hibernation, like bears? Could they have been warm-blooded, like birds and mammals? Top researchers from Texas, Australia, and the United Kingdom converge on the freezing tundra to unearth some startling new answers.

Tony Fiorillo, curator of earth sciences at the Dallas museum, is one of the scientists featured in the NOVA production.  The film highlights the museum’s efforts to push science work as well as displays for the public.

Previously, the museum had relied on Texas volunteers to help unearth and mount displays on prehistoric creatures from Texas, under the direction of Charles Finsley, a venerable Texas geologist.  One one hand, it’s good to see the level of science kicked up a notch or two.  On the other hand, it was great to have such a high level outlet for amateur and future, volunteer scientists at a major  museum.

October 2008 — Uganda is nearing the end of the season when the national health service sprays DDT inside homes to discourage mosquitoes from biting, and spreading malaria.  Results from DDT use this year show no improvement over the previous year, and in some cases malaria rates are higher.

BBC map of Uganda, showing Apac Province. Apac is victim to terrorism by the

BBC map of Uganda, showing Apac Province. Apac is victim to terrorism by the “Lord’s Resistance Army” and other armed bandits, as well as being the most malaria-ridden area of the world.

The story from The Observer in Kampala, via All-Africa.com news, provides some of the details, but little analysis to be debated.  Is the failure of the program due to partial implementation, since implementation was resisted by businesses and cotton farmers?  Or is DDT simply ineffective?  It’s nearly impossible to tell from data available so far.

High school students weren’t alive when Yellowstone burned in 1988. Do you remember?

NASA infrared satellite photograph of Yellowstone fires in 1988

NASA infrared satellite photograph of Yellowstone fires in 1988

It was a conflagration that made hell look like good picnicking. 1988 was a particularly dry summer, and hot. Lightning and human carelessness ignited fires across western North America. Five huge fires raged out of control, and burned huge swaths out of forests in Yellowstone National Park that probably hadn’t seen fire in 80 years, maybe longer.

The Salt Lake Tribune featured several stories about the fires and Yellowstone’s recovery today, “Yellowstone: Back from the ashes,” how wildland firefighting changed, a great chart on fire succession stages, and another chart on the effects of the fire on larger animals in the Yellowstone system.

Old Faithfull erupts against background of smoke from 1988 fires - NPS photo by Deanna Marie Dulen

Old Faithfull erupts against background of smoke from 1988 fires - NPS photo by Deanna Marie Dulen

The 1988 fires made history in several ways; it was the first time so many fires had burned simultaneously. Ultimately some of the fires merged into even greater conflagrations. The fires forced the shutdown of tourism and other activities in the Park. Inadequacies in fire fighting equipment, staffing and policies were highlighted and displayed in newspapers and on television for weeks, forcing changes in policies by cities, states and the federal government.

Some good came out of the fires. Much undergrowth and dead wood had choked off plant diversity in some places in the Park. The fires opened new meadows and offered opportunities for some species to expand their ranges.

Scientifically, a lot of information came out of the fires. The mystery of when aspen would seed out was solved — new aspen seedlings appeared in areas where the fires had sterilized the ground with extremely high temperatures that seemed to trigger the seeds to germinate.

Scientists at the University of Texas at Austin showed off their petawatt LASER last week (alas, couldn’t make the open house myself).

LASER project manager Todd Ditmire summed it up:  “Big LASERs are cool.”

The $15 million laser creates a beam that is brighter than the surface of the sun. The pulses of light can reach 1 quadrillion watts (a petawatt) but last just one-tenth of a trillionth of a second.

Scientists such as Todd Ditmire, a UT physics researcher, will use the laser to heat substances to incredibly high temperatures for incredibly short periods of time, approximating the conditions at the center of a star. It’s also expected to help the U.S. Department of Energy in its ambitious research effort to create a laser-based controlled fusion energy source, which might one day be the ultimate clean energy source for the country.
